Output 5d23020a940b0eafbdfb63d5e611c97a8997dd0110e4911c323de0ddbbfdeff8:6

value
2873081461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ab77842025f42bf7f98b62fb9f13bb8b4e2834 OP_EQUAL
address
33wTYseGxrWa7Suw5h3j2e1StBwusKLAaG
transaction
5d23020a940b0eafbdfb63d5e611c97a8997dd0110e4911c323de0ddbbfdeff8
confirmations
266552
spent
true